JAVA中提示“非法字符”

很短的一个继承的实例classAextendsB{intgrade;A(){}voidfuntion(){System.out.println("");}}报错在构造函数... 很短的一个继承的实例
class A extends B{
int grade;

A(){
}

void funtion(){
System.out.println(" ");

}

}
报错在构造函数的地方,是不是继承中不能使用构造函数呢?小弟初学
那个我改了一下子类和父类的名字,以前的叫Person和Student,我自己改成了A和B,父类的编译没有报错,下面的是父类class Person{ String name; int age; Person(int age){ System.out.println(this.age); } void eat(){ System.out.println("eat"); } void introduce(){ System.out.println("name is " + name + ",age is " + age); } }
这是编译的结果
展开
 我来答
大大大大流氓兔
2014-08-27 · TA获得超过302个赞
知道小有建树答主
回答量:189
采纳率:96%
帮助的人:119万
展开全部
package a;

public class A extends B{
int grade;
public A() {
// TODO Auto-generated constructor stub
}
void function(){
System.out.println("You are success!");
}
public static void main(String[] args){
A a = new A();
a.function();
}
}

class B{
public B(){

}
}
亲 以上是我的代码,没有问题 至于你的 建议你还是把或御仿所有代码和错误都上衫纤传吧,你现拆迅在的代码看上去 没有什么错误!~~~
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
yh1234cc
2014-08-27 · TA获得超过146个赞
知道小有建树答主
回答量:144
采纳率:0%
帮助的人:110万
展开全部
Student.java 的内容呢. 你Student.java编译报错,把其他一大堆贴上链枝来干嘛.

你是不是直接改了代码, class Student extends Person 改成class A extends B. 然后Student.java文件的文件名备答没仿唤慧改?.
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
窝没欠你钱
2016-01-08 · 超过28用户采纳过TA的回答
知道答主
回答量:54
采纳率:0%
帮助的人:37万
展开全部
就是一些JAVA不能使用的字符,比如你用了\这个是转义字符是不允许使用的
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
七七八八LP
2014-08-27 · 超过21用户采纳过TA的回答
知道答主
回答量:78
采纳率:50%
帮助的人:44.7万
展开全部
你的类路径中不要用中文或空格。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
dongyijun521
2014-08-27 · TA获得超过360个赞
知道答主
回答量:26
采纳率:0%
帮助的人:30.6万
展开全部
代码没贴全啊,A类的代码呢?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 3条折叠回答
收起 更多回答(5)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式